GUIDO RENI
Portrait of Cardinal Camillo BorgheseOil on canvas158.4 x 116.2 cm;
62 3/8 x 45 3/4 in.Provenance
Castello di Torre Ratti?;
Marchese Montebruno, Genoa?;
Swedish Art Market;
Colen Art, Lugano, before 1985;
Matthiesen Gallery by 1993;
M.F. Collection.Exhibitions
London, Matthiesen Fine Art Ltd., Around 1610: The Onset of the Baroque, 1985, no. 10 (where identified as Scipione Borghese), on loan.Literature
